#16098b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16098b is composed of 8.6% red, 3.5%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 246 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 29%. #16098b color hex could be obtained by blending #2c12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#16098b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16098b has RGB values of R:22, G:9,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1444235.

Shades and Tints of #16098b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010a is the darkest color, while #f7f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#16098b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48484c is the less saturated color, while #110391 is the most saturated one.
